eLocks Specifications

eLocks™ Controller™ Systems are designed for efficiency, security, effectiveness and reliability for electronic code generation. The keyless lock systems are based on a self contained, micro processor based, battery powered, single door access control device that grants access through a time sensitive code. Access can be granted from anywhere in the world by accessing the eData Locks software and an Internet connection.

eData Collectors’ robust eLock Controller™ Systems are ADA compliant and designed to be used in harsh environments. No electricity or maintenance is required to operate. eData Chips are water proof and heat resistant. The systems offer User Lockout Mode with timer, Anti-damper – prevents code guessing and Manual Key Override

eLock Codes are assigned by management to allow staff, guests and students access specific door or doors, for a specified period of time (date/time). Staff and guests can use the eCode provided by management for a determined amount of time. Management has the ability to change, at any time, eLock Codes to extend or restrict the amount of time staff or guest can have access or just simple allow for the eLock Code to automatically expire. eLock Controller™ System features:

Characteristics

eLocks diagram eLocks Specifications

  1. Rust-proof heavy duty lock chassis
  2. Rust free stainless steel rose
  3. Forged brass levers meet ADA requirements
  4. Heavy duty spring cage prevents sagging levers
  5. High performance Molex® wire connector
  6. “UL” listed latch for 3 hour fire labeled doors
  7. Die cast steel retractor with bronze roller bearings for extended life cycle
 
  • General Specifications - Featuring clutch System, freewheeling to deter breaking of the handle.
  • Cylinders & Keyways - 6 pin solid brass “C” keyway standard.
  • Interchangeable Core - Interchangeable core locks will accept 6 or 7 pin cores compatible with BEST, FALCON and ARROW.
  • Latch Options - “UL” listed for 3 hour fire labeled doors. 2-3/4″ backset standards, 2-3/8″ backset optional.
  • Door Range - 1-3/8″ to 1-3/4″ thickness. 2″ to 2 – 1/4″ thickness also available upon request.
  • Strikes - ASA 1-1/4″x4-7/8″ standard.
  • ANSI Standards - Meets or exceeds of BHMA/ANSI A 156.2 Series 4000, grade 1 requirements.
  • ADA Compliant - Meets ADA requirements, designed for Barrier
